Course Content

• Film Review Structure and Analysis
• Identifying Bias and Subjectivity in Film Criticism
• The Language of Film: Visual and Narrative Techniques
• Assessing Film Reviews: Criteria and Methodologies
• Genre Conventions and their Influence on Film Reviews
• Ethical Considerations in Film Criticism
• Contextualizing Film Reviews: Historical and Cultural Influences
• Understanding Auteur Theory and its Impact on Critical Assessment
• Comparative Film Review Analysis (Advanced)
• Writing Effective Film Reviews and Critical Essays
